Would you
risk
death
for a hug?
A hug,
with the one.
The one
that means
the most
Lives in
your heart,
occupying
every corner
of it’s
emptiness.
The one that’s
just a ping,
in an
echo chamber.
Would you risk
death
for such a thing?

I wrote this to express, how some of us are left waiting for love to arrive while in perpetual delay.
